def test_xmlvalue(self): instance = builtins.Duration() value = isodate.parse_duration("P0Y1347M0D") assert instance.xmlvalue(value) == "P1347M" assert instance.xmlvalue("P0Y1347M0D") == "P1347M" assert instance.xmlvalue(datetime.timedelta(days=1347)) == "P1347D" with pytest.raises(ValueError): instance.xmlvalue("P15T")
def test_pythonvalue(self): instance = builtins.Duration() expected = isodate.parse_duration("P0Y1347M0D") value = "P0Y1347M0D" assert instance.pythonvalue(value) == expected expected = isodate.parse_duration("P0Y1347M0D") value = "\r \nP0Y1347M0D\t " assert instance.pythonvalue(value) == expected
def test_xmlvalue(self): instance = builtins.Duration() value = isodate.parse_duration("P0Y1347M0D") assert instance.xmlvalue(value) == "P1347M"
def test_pythonvalue(self): instance = builtins.Duration() expected = isodate.parse_duration('P0Y1347M0D') value = 'P0Y1347M0D' assert instance.pythonvalue(value) == expected